Gene ID | LotjaGi2g1v0174300 |
Transcript ID | LotjaGi2g1v0174300.1 |
Lotus japonicus genome version | Gifu v1.2 |
Description | Carboxyl methyltransferase; TAIR: AT3G11480.1 S-adenosyl-L-methionine-dependent methyltransferases superfamily protein; Swiss-Prot: sp|Q9SPV4|SAMT_CLABR Salicylate carboxymethyltransferase; TrEMBL-Plants: tr|B7FIK3|B7FIK3_MEDTR Salicylic acid carboxyl methyltransferase; Found in the gene: LotjaGi2g1v0174300 |
